Deskewing the Probes and Channels
To ensure accurate measurements, you must deskew the probes before you take
measurements from your unit under test. The deskew process is where the
oscilloscope adjusts the relative delay between the signals to accurately time
correlate the displayed waveforms.
The application includes an automated deskew utility that you can use to deskew
any pair of oscilloscope channels.
Note 1:
It is recommended that you use the deskew fixture specified in the
accessories section to perform deskew. The deskew source can be the built-in
probe compensation signal in the oscilloscope or an external signal source.
Note 2:
The oscilloscope has a deskew range of 50 ns.
Deskewing Probes and Channels on the supported Instruments
To deskew probes and channels on the supported instruments, follow these steps:
1.
Connect the probes to Ch1 and Ch2 on the oscilloscope.
2.
Connect the probe compensation signal to the deskew fixture. You can use
the probe compensation signal from the oscilloscope as the source for the
deskew fixture.
3.
Follow the on-screen prompts for the deskew operation with an external
source.
